Responsibilities
- Operate production and packaging equipment safely and efficiently to support enzyme manufacturing operations.
- Perform logistics activities, including warehousing, bulk material unloading, inventory movement, and product packaging.
- Monitor equipment performance and process parameters to ensure production targets, quality standards, and operational efficiency are achieved.
- Utilize the Delta V process control system to monitor, control, and adjust production operations.
- Troubleshoot equipment and process issues and collaborate with maintenance and engineering teams to minimize downtime.
- Complete routine inspections, equipment checks, and accurate production documentation to maintain compliance requirements.
- Support continuous improvement initiatives by identifying opportunities to optimize processes, safety, and productivity.
- Follow all safety, environmental, quality, and operational procedures to maintain a safe and compliant workplace.
